		Within Our Gates by Oscar Michaeux.
Oldest known surviving film made by an African-American director.
1920’s silent film. Portrays the contemporary radical situation in the United States during the early 20th Century – the years of Jim Crow, the revival of the Klan, the Great Migration of blacks to cities of the North and Midwest, and the emergence of the ‘New Negro.’
